Issue 1943 in reviewboard: [ReviewBoard] Sending e-mail raise exception in Django framework (under some condition)
Status: New Owner: Labels: Type-Defect Priority-Medium New issue 1943 by Jan.Koprowski: [ReviewBoard] Sending e-mail raise exception in Django framework (under some condition) http://code.google.com/p/reviewboard/issues/detail?id=1943 What version are you running? ReviewBoard 1.5 What steps will reproduce the problem? 1. Create robot user in admin panel but don't set e-mail for them 2. Send review using post-review on behalf someone using robot username publishing it and passing all necessary informations in parameters 3. Look do Apache logs. Django was crashed sending e-mail What is the expected output? What do you see instead? E-mail should be send to reviewer and submitter. Instead of that I see following in Apache log: [Tue Jan 11 09:44:36 2011] [error] ERROR:root:Error sending e-mail notification with subject 'Review title' to 'Jan Koprowski submitter@address,,Christina Hammond reviewer@address': need more than 1 value to unpack [Tue Jan 11 09:44:36 2011] [error] Traceback (most recent call last): [Tue Jan 11 09:44:36 2011] [error] File /reviewboard/lib/python2.7/site-packages/ReviewBoard-1.5.00.000.0_intel-py2.7.egg/reviewboard/notifications/email.py, line 177, in send_review_mail [Tue Jan 11 09:44:36 2011] [error] message.send() [Tue Jan 11 09:44:36 2011] [error] File /reviewboard/lib/python2.7/site-packages/Django-1.2.4-py2.7.egg/django/core/mail/message.py, line 179, in send [Tue Jan 11 09:44:36 2011] [error] return self.get_connection(fail_silently).send_messages([self]) [Tue Jan 11 09:44:36 2011] [error] File /reviewboard/lib/python2.7/site-packages/Django-1.2.4-py2.7.egg/django/core/mail/backends/smtp.py, line 85, in send_messages [Tue Jan 11 09:44:36 2011] [error] sent = self._send(message) [Tue Jan 11 09:44:36 2011] [error] File /reviewboard/lib/python2.7/site-packages/Django-1.2.4-py2.7.egg/django/core/mail/backends/smtp.py, line 104, in _send [Tue Jan 11 09:44:36 2011] [error] recipients = map(self._sanitize, email_message.recipients()) [Tue Jan 11 09:44:36 2011] [error] File /reviewboard/lib/python2.7/site-packages/Django-1.2.4-py2.7.egg/django/core/mail/backends/smtp.py, line 95, in _sanitize [Tue Jan 11 09:44:36 2011] [error] name, domain = email.split('@', 1) [Tue Jan 11 09:44:36 2011] [error] ValueError: need more than 1 value to unpack What operating system are you using? What browser? Linux Apache2 mod_wsgi Please provide any additional information below. Cause of this issue is in reviewboard/notification/email.py in function send_review_mail (approximately line 122): from_email = get_email_address_for_user(user) recipients = set([from_email]) In those lines from_email is empty and add empty element to set of recipients. -- You received this message because you are subscribed to the Google Groups reviewboard-issues group. Issue 1944 in reviewboard: post-review .reviewboardrc location calculation is not portable in windows
Status: New Owner: Labels: Type-Defect Priority-Medium New issue 1944 by mt02caro: post-review .reviewboardrc location calculation is not portable in windows http://code.google.com/p/reviewboard/issues/detail?id=1944 What version are you running? 0.8 What's the URL of the page containing the problem? - What steps will reproduce the problem? 1. Put .reviewboardrc in %APPDATA% (for vista this is not ..\Local Settings\Application Data (it doesn't exist) but something like C:\Users\user\AppData\Roaming, which is not constant, ofcourse. 2. Use post-review and see if it loads the server url correctly. What is the expected output? What do you see instead? post-review should load .reviewboardrc from %APPDATA% and not %USERPROFILE%\Local Settings\Application Data What operating system are you using? What browser? Windows Vista Please provide any additional information below. To make post-review portable cross windows versions the homepath calculation in post-review.py::main should simply be the APPDATA environment variable. Perhaps leave the current calculation as a fallback. A patch for this has been attached.
